#4cf09b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4cf09b is composed of 29.8% red, 94.1%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.4%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 148.9 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 62%. #4cf09b color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#00e137.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#4cf09b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4cf09b has RGB values of R:76, G:240,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 5042331.

Shades and Tints of #4cf09b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#effef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4cf09b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#97a59e is the less saturated color, while #3dff9a is the most saturated one.
